Subject: [PATCH 4/8] tracing/probe: Check maxactive error cases

From: Masami Hiramatsu <mhiramat@...nel.org>

Check maxactive on kprobe error case, because maxactive
is only for kretprobe, not for kprobe. Also, maxactive
should not be 0, it should be at least 1.
